Konsta Tiihonen wrote:
> I opened the port 5432 inbound and outbound already. As far as I konw
> there are some other ports for negotiation as well. I opened those up,
> too. Connecting to it is not possible. The postgreSQL service is
> running on the same machine, so there is no other machine I could try
> to connect from.
There are no other negotiation ports in PostgreSQL.
What's the exact error message you're getting?
